/** * Campaign endpoints configuration * Each endpoint can override ALL global settings */ export declare const campaignEndpoints: { readonly getCampaign: { readonly url: "/campaigns/:id"; readonly method: "GET"; }; readonly listCampaigns: { readonly url: "/campaigns"; readonly method: "GET"; }; readonly createCampaign: { readonly url: "/campaigns"; readonly method: "POST"; }; readonly updateCampaign: { readonly url: "/campaigns/:id"; readonly method: "PUT"; }; readonly deleteCampaign: { readonly url: "/campaigns/:id"; readonly method: "DELETE"; }; readonly getCampaignStats: { readonly url: "/campaigns/:id/stats"; readonly method: "GET"; }; readonly getCampaignParticipants: { readonly url: "/campaigns/:id/participants"; readonly method: "GET"; }; readonly joinCampaign: { readonly url: "/campaigns/:id/join"; readonly method: "POST"; }; readonly leaveCampaign: { readonly url: "/campaigns/:id/leave"; readonly method: "POST"; }; }; //# sourceMappingURL=campaigns.d.ts.map